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21944736 18374213108 403748601 760096596 056
951 6966900
951 6966900
62385 1363532377 5579011
All about undefined
Interested in learning more?
951 6966900
62385 1363532377 5579011
See more
796342412 66952999419 2599194143
64113055 68084 3537
See more
9565 71311086255 3098851462
8591 373 29665592041
See more